Full Description

{1} 28 Roman bronze coins were found predominantly C3rd-C4th. Including issues of Hadrian, Faustina II, Marcus Aurelius, Carausius, Maximus II, Constantine I and the House of Theodosius. Two bronze brooches and two lead weights.

{2} Metal finds of the Romano-British period included 33 coins and 2 brooches.
